This makes me very nostalgic for Luigi's Mansion, but I don't actually like that feeling very much.
Emulating the experience of playing an old game through animation is an idea with a lot of novelty, but it also puts the viewer in a situation where they are essentially watching someone else playing a really cool game that is forever out of reach; which is both tantalizing and a bit boring since the author is the only one in control of the experience.
That said, the story is really fun, the characters are great and the style is very captivating!

I hope to see more of this, just needs some work on the sound department I think, it seemed a bit muted
